Jerry Kill's 'genuine' leadership as asset for the Gophers
The University of Minnesota football team plays its first game of the season Saturday on the road against the University of Southern California. Gopher fans are optimistic about the future because of the team's new coach, Jerry Kill.
"The one word people use to sum up Jerry Kill, and you hear it all the time, is 'genuine,'" Star Tribune sportswriter Phil Miller said. "You did not hear that with his predecessor."
Miller spoke with MPR's Cathy Wurzer on Morning Edition.
